How do you convert ohms to microsiemens?
To convert a mho measurement to a microsiemens measurement, multiply the electrical conductance by the conversion ratio. The electrical conductance in microsiemens is equal to the mhos multiplied by 1,000,000.
How do you convert Millisiemens to ohms?
To convert a millisiemens measurement to a mho measurement, divide the electrical conductance by the conversion ratio. The electrical conductance in mhos is equal to the millisiemens divided by 1,000.

Are Micromhos and microsiemens the same?
The micromho is a unit of electrical conductance equal to 1/1,000,000 of a mho, which is the reciprocal of the resistance in ohms. One micromho is equal to one microsiemens.

What is Umhos?
The unit of measurement for conductivity is expressed in either microSiemens (uS/cm) or micromhos (umho/cm) which is the reciprocal of the unit of resistance, the ohm. The prefix “micro” means that it is measured in millionths of a mho. MicroSiemens and micromhos are equivalent units.
What do you understand by electrical conductance?
Electrical conductance measures how easily electricity flows through electrical components for a given voltage difference. Electrical conductance is a property of a particular electrical component (like a particular wire), while conductivity is a property of the material itself (like silver).
Is conductivity measured in ohms?
The electrical conductivity units are siemens per metre, S⋅m-1. The siemens also used to be referred to as a mho – this is the reciprocal of a an ohm, and this is inferred by spelling ohm backwards. Conductance is the reciprocal of resistance and one siemens is equal to the reciprocal of one ohm.

How many siemens is an ohm?
one siemens
Conductance, susceptance, and admittance are the reciprocals of resistance, reactance, and impedance respectively; hence one siemens is redundantly equal to the reciprocal of one ohm (Ω−1) and is also referred to as the mho.

How many Siemens are in 1 microsiemens?
So 1 microsiemens = 10 -6 siemens. The definition of a siemens is as follows: The siemens is the SI derived unit of electric conductance. It is equal to inverse ohm. It is named after the German inventor and industrialist Ernst Werner von Siemens, and was previously called the mho.
